    Make sure we always have Shift+Del as shortcut · cdd002c5
    Elvis Angelaccio authored
    After commit 68bb0ec2 the shortcut for the Delete action is not
    necessarily Shift+Del, but whatever the user set in System Setting.
    However DolphinRemoveAction assumes/hardcodes Shift+Del, so we should
    always make sure we have this shortcut around, for consistency.
    
    We just need to add it (if necessary) to the list of shortcuts of the
    action. However:
    
    * for the actual Delete action, we need to append it (if we'd prepend it,
      it would override a custom primary shortcut in the 'Configure Shortcuts' dialog).
    * for DolphinRemoveAction, we need to prepend it in order to have
      Shift+Del (rather than the custom primary shortcut) in the context menu.
